What Causes 1706 Error? You may receive the error when any of the conditions given below holds true: Windows installer in unable to find the source files to run the setup of the program you are trying error 1706 to install. The program for which you are trying to run the setup was originally installed through network administrative installation, which is no longer available. You are trying to run the setup from CD-ROM, when you are actually being prompted by Windows Installer to provide source location of the program's installation files. You click the Cancel button when the installer prompts you to provide the path to your CD. error 1706 office When you are in Maintenance mode or while trying to uninstall an application. Many times, the error is displayed when installing software patches and other minor upgrades. During installation of a program that uses Windows Installer to perform the setup, the original installation or the MSI package is cached in the C:\winnt\Installer directory. This is done mainly for maintenance or repair. Improper caching of MSI file is one of the main causes of the error. Fix Windows Installer 1706 Error Let's now have a look at the some of the methods that you can use to fix the error. In case you are installing from the Web and you are prompted to browse to MSI package, then you must first ensure that when you double-click on the Setup.exe file, it looks for the MSI package in the correct location. To check this, you need to open Release Wizard, and verify that the URL specified for the Web server has the MSI package that must be downloaded to install your program. When installing over the network, you must ensure that you have full rights (read-write-execute) to the network location from where you are running the setup. This error is caused by several issues with the Office installer, and has its roots with the likes of having administrative privileges, having corrupt / damaged files, or just not using the CD properly. You may receive an error that looks similar to the following: "Error 1706. Setup cannot find the required files. Check your connection to the network, or CD-ROM drive. For other potential solutions to this problem, see C:\Program Files\Microsoft Office\Office10\1033\Setup.hlp." What Causes The 1706 Error There a several causes of the Installer Error 1706, of which here are the most common: You originally installed Microsoft Office from a network administrative installation. The network administrative installation is no longer available to you. You are trying to use an Office CD-ROM when you are prompted by the Windows Installer for an Office source location. You click Cancel when you are prompted to Insert the CD You have registry errors on your PC The Windows Installer cannot work out the difference between two source types, because the files in an administrative installation are uncompressed, and the files on an Office CD-ROM are compressed. How To Fix The 1706 Error Step 1 - Download The Latest Version Of Install Shield Install Shield often receives updates to ensure it can with stand all of the latest files. If you are receiving the 1706 error, then it is likely that your InstallShield could possibly be out of date, and recommended that you update it. To do this, you need to be able to download the latest version of InstallShield from their website. Step 2 - Make Sure You Click “Setup.exe” (Not The MSI File) Clicking on the "MSI" file will result in the 1706 error, as it will not have the range of options needed to run. To fix this you should click the Setup.exe application that the program will have. Setup.exe will utilitize the MSI file, and will bring all the different connections together, allowing your computer to run much smoother with the installer working as well as it should. Step 3 - Use An Alternative Network Solution Not having the correct network permissions can result in the 1706 error, because some networks have different protocols. If you don't have the correct network permissions then the permission barriers can prevent you from installing the programs you need, making it a recommended step to use a different network solution.
